Allure of the Seas is an Oasis-class cruise ship owned and operated by Royal Caribbean International. The Oasis class ships were the largest passenger vessels in service until 2024, when the Icon-class ship, Icon of the Seas, surpassed them to become the world's largest cruise ship. Allure is 50 millimetres (2.0 in) longer than her sister ship Oasis of the Seas, though both were built to the same specifications.
